UK General Election 2024: Labour Secures Decisive Victory

Anti-Incumbent Revolt Leads to Labour's Success

The recently concluded United Kingdom General Election 2024 witnessed a decisive victory for the Labour Party, marking a significant shift in the political landscape. The election, widely seen as an anti-incumbent revolt, resulted in the Labour Party's return to power after five years in opposition.

Polling Highlights Labour Dominance

Exit polls conducted shortly before the closing of voting booths projected a clear lead for the Labour Party. The polls accurately predicted the Labour Party's strong performance, with analysts attributing it to widespread dissatisfaction with the incumbent Conservative government.

Boundary Changes Impact Representation

It is worth noting that since the previous election in 2019, there were substantial changes to UK parliamentary constituency boundaries. These alterations affected approximately 90% of constituencies, potentially influencing the distribution of seats.

Liberal Democrats Gain Ground

In addition to Labour's triumph, the Liberal Democrats, traditionally considered the third party in British politics, also experienced significant gains. The party increased its representation in the House of Commons, moving from just 11 seats in the 2019 election to a much larger number this year.

Keir Starmer Claims Victory

Labour Party leader Keir Starmer hailed his party's victory as a historic win. Addressing supporters, Starmer pledged to address the concerns of voters and work towards a fairer and more prosperous future for the United Kingdom.

Sunak Concedes Defeat

Outgoing Prime Minister Rishi Sunak from the Conservative Party conceded defeat and congratulated Starmer on his success. Sunak acknowledged the difficult challenges faced by the government and expressed his commitment to ensuring a smooth transition of power.
